LED court lighting installation that extends usable hours on public tennis, pickleball, and basketball courts.
Adding or upgrading court lighting lets agencies expand recreation access into evening hours while controlling energy costs. We install LED fixtures, poles, and controls designed to deliver even playing-surface illumination with minimal spill onto neighboring properties. Work is coordinated with licensed electrical partners to meet code and the dark-sky ordinances common in Western Washington jurisdictions. Photometric layouts confirm light levels meet recreation standards before final acceptance.
Extends court availability into evening hours; Reduces energy use with efficient LED fixtures; Limits light spill to meet local ordinances; Delivers even, glare-controlled playing surface illumination
1) Prepare a photometric layout for the court; 2) Set poles and run conduit with licensed electricians; 3) Mount LED fixtures and controls; 4) Aim, test, and verify illumination levels
Number of poles and fixtures required; Trenching and electrical service distance; Fixture wattage and control systems; Permitting and ordinance compliance; Prevailing wage on public electrical work
Dry summer and early-fall conditions ease trenching and foundation work for new lighting.
